  • Study of the continuum generated by in-line filtering of solitons. Abstract Text:

    t georgesT Georges,m borgM Borg,

    The continuum generated by the filtering of solitons is studied analytically by use of a perturbation theory and numerically verified. The method applies to any filter transfer function and to sliding-frequency filtering as well. A general method for finding the input pulse adapted to a transmission line is presented and applied to the case of filtering.
